Irish Aid is the Government of Ireland's programme of assistance to developing countries operating under Embassy of Ireland in Tanzania. The Irish Aid programme is an integral part of the foreign policy of the Government of Ireland and the Irish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ade. Irish Aid works in close partnership with recipient countries, with other donors and multilateral organisations and with non-governmental organisations and missionaries. The Embassy is seeking to recruit a qualified and experienced Development Advisor responsible for governance and cross cutting issues.
The Development Advisor will maintain responsibility for embedding governance and mainstreaming gender across the programme; and for support to domestic accountability in accordance with the Irish Aid Country Strategy Plan
(CSP) and results framework and the 2013 work plan.
The CSP is delivered through the following two key streams of activity:
Support to governance and accountability as well as gender equality through state and non state partnership under the three sectoral objectives of health, agriculture and nutrition
Cross programme support to governance reform, enhanced local service delivery and domestic accountability as articulated in the annual cross cutting work plan
